Movement 515 is an urban arts community where, twice a week, students and mentors come together to create spoken word poetry and graffiti art. Attempting to slow down the world and investigate themselves, they work toward becoming change agents, shedding light on the impact human emotion and connection brings to the global community.

URBAN ARTS CAMP
Movement 515 Summer Urban Arts Camp is a 2-week intensive creative arts camp for incoming 8th and 9th grade students, with a focus on spoken word poetry and performance, emceeing and music production, or the art of graffiti. The 2-week camp is planned and facilitated by graduated Movement 515 poets, as well as local and national teaching artists.
